Market Overview

Pea protein has emerged as a leading plant-based protein alternative due to its high nutritional value, allergen-free nature, and sustainability benefits. Extracted primarily from yellow peas, pea protein is widely used in food and beverages, dietary supplements, animal feed, and personal care products.

The global demand for plant-based protein is surging as consumers shift toward vegan, vegetarian, and flexitarian diets. This transition is fueled by concerns over health, sustainability, and ethical consumption. Pea protein is particularly popular due to its high protein content, essential amino acids, and easy digestibility.

The market is experiencing robust growth, driven by the rise in plant-based meat alternatives, protein-rich snacks, and sports nutrition products. Additionally, advancements in pea protein processing technology have improved texture and taste, further expanding its applications in the food industry.

Market Segmentation

Pea protein is available as isolate (high protein, used in supplements and dairy alternatives), concentrate (moderate protein, used in snacks and cereals), and textured protein (used in plant-based meat). Derived mainly from yellow peas for their superior texture and solubility, it is widely used in food & beverages, sports nutrition, animal feed, and personal care products.

Regional Analysis

North America leads the pea protein market, driven by rising plant-based food demand, strong manufacturer presence, and FDA approval. Europe is expanding rapidly due to a growing vegan population and sustainability initiatives. Asia-Pacific sees rising demand, especially in China and India, with government support for plant-based proteins. Latin America and the Middle East/Africa show growth potential, fueled by dairy alternative demand and increasing health awareness.
